Romance Is In The Air - Holiday Destinations

By: Ken Morris

Are you looking for a romantic vacation spot to get away from the hustle and bustle of everyday life and enjoy alone time with your special someone? There are many destinations to choose from and choosing one really depends on what your idea of romance is but it's generally a picturesque location where there is plenty of peace and quiet.

Many choose to vacation in a tropical destination. Tropical holiday spots offer peace and quiet but also plenty of fun-in-the-sun activities. Imagine watching sunsets on the beach while sipping a cocktails with your partner.

Barbados is one romantic getaway that is sure to please. Its Eastern Caribbean location is a short flight for those who live on the East Coast and it's known for it's coastal vistas and beaches. Barbados offers intimacy and seclusion but also a great deal of dining, nightlife and shopping options.

Another warm weather romantic holiday spot is Tahiti, located in the Pacific Ocean. Not only is Tahiti full of beautiful beaches but it also offers a taste of culture since it is part of French Polynesia. The equatorial location ensures beautiful tropical weather year round. Many resorts cater to couples on romantic getaways and their facilities are geared towards couples looking for quiet time.

Also located in the Pacific Ocean but a little closer to home (and no passport needed) are the Hawaiian Islands. The six islands are each unique and offer something for everyone. The most secluded are Kauai (nicknamed the "Garden Isle) and the Big Island of Hawaii. If you want a combination of seclusion and nightlife then Maui offers a nice selection of resorts and entertainment options. Not only is Hawaii a tropical paradise but the people are known for their easy going attitude hence the motto "Aloha State".

Beach destinations aren't for everyone; you might not like the hot weather or the high price tag. On the East Coast the Pocono Mountains offers fresh air and plenty of places to spend time with your honey. Similarly, Big Sur in the West offers fresh saltwater air and gorgeous coastal views.

If you have the time and money you may consider a European city that is brimming with romance. The cities of Paris, Venice, Nice and Vienna are known to "have love in the air". If you are on a tighter budget consider lesser tourist trodden (but just as nice) cities of Prague, Istanbul and Tallinn.

Get away from the stress of everyday living and travel to a vacation spot where you can have quiet time with your special someone.
